Stuart MacRae

Head Of Product - Global at Flight Centre Travel Group

Stuart MacRae is currently the Head of Product - Global at Flight Centre Travel Group, where Stuart is responsible for the direction and commercialization of the Flight Centre Independent Ecosystem. Prior to this, Stuart held positions such as Head of Product / Portfolio at Equifax and Senior Product Manager at TSB New Zealand. Stuart has a strong background in product management and has led teams to drive organizational changes, increase profitability, and ensure customer satisfaction.

Links

Previous companies

Westpac New Zealand logo
Equifax logo
Genesis Energy logo

Timeline

  • Head Of Product - Global

    August, 2023 - present